What is Meri Fasal Mera Byora Haryana?
Meri Fasal Mera Byora Haryana is a digital initiative by the Department of Agriculture and Farmers Welfare, Haryana, designed to streamline farmer and crop registration. The portal integrates with systems like e-Kharid for MSP procurement and land records for accuracy, ensuring transparency and efficiency. Farmers can register details of their crops, land, and bank accounts to access government benefits.
- Purpose: Facilitates MSP procurement, subsidies, and compensation for crop losses.
- Key Features: Farmer registration, crop details, subsidy tracking, and integration with e-Kharid for market sales.
Example: A farmer in Hisar can register their paddy crop on the portal to sell at MSP and claim ₹4,000 per acre under the Mera Pani Meri Virasat scheme.
How to Register on Meri Fasal Mera Byora Haryana
Registering on the Meri Fasal Mera Byora Haryana portal is straightforward and can be done online or at Common Service Centres (CSCs). Here’s the step-by-step process:
- Visit the Official Portal: Go to fasal.haryana.gov.in. The portal is available in English and Hindi for ease of use.
- Select Farmer Section: Click on “Farmer Reg./Login” or “किसान अनुभाग” on the homepage.
- Enter Mobile Number: Input your registered mobile number and captcha code.
- Verify OTP: Receive an OTP via SMS, enter it, and click “Login.”
- Choose ID Option: Select either Parivar Pehchan Patra (PPP) ID or Aadhaar number:
- For PPP: Enter the PPP number and click “Validate.”
- For Aadhaar: Enter the Aadhaar number, click “Send OTP,” verify with OTP, and submit.
- Fill Registration Form: Provide details like:
- Land ownership (Khasra number, land size).
- Crop type (e.g., wheat, paddy).
- Sowing area and mandi for sale.
- Bank account details for direct benefit transfer (DBT).
- Submit and Save: Review details, click “Submit,” and note the Registration Enrollment Number for tracking. Download the confirmation for records.
Example: A farmer in Karnal uses their Aadhaar number to register 3 acres of wheat, selects a local mandi, and submits the form to access MSP benefits.
Deadlines for FY 2025-26
The Meri Fasal Mera Byora Haryana portal has specific registration deadlines for crops, varying by season. For FY 2025-26, based on past trends and recent updates:
Season | Crop Examples | Registration Period | Deadline (Tentative) |
---|---|---|---|
Kharif | Paddy, Maize, Cotton | June–August 2025 | August 15, 2025 |
Rabi | Wheat, Barley, Mustard | December 2025–January 2026 | January 15, 2026 |
Special Drives | Direct Seeding of Paddy | Periodic reopenings (e.g., August 2024) | To be announced |
- Note: Deadlines may be extended, as seen in August 2024 (August 11–18). Check fasal.haryana.gov.in for updates.
Example: A farmer must register their mustard crop by January 15, 2026, to sell at MSP in the Rabi season.
Benefits and Challenges
Benefits:
- MSP Procurement: Only registered crops qualify for sale at MSP through e-Kharid.
- Subsidies: Access to subsidies on seeds, fertilizers, and equipment, like ₹4,000 per acre for water-saving crops.
- Crop Insurance: Compensation for losses due to natural calamities under schemes like Pradhan Mantri Fasal Bima Yojana.
- Transparency: Direct benefit transfers eliminate middlemen, ensuring fair payments.
- Real-Time Information: Updates on sowing, harvesting, and market trends.
Challenges:
- Technical Issues: Portal glitches or slow internet in rural areas can hinder registration.
- Awareness Gaps: Many farmers miss deadlines due to lack of awareness.
- Document Errors: Incorrect Aadhaar or land details can lead to rejection.
Tips: Use CSCs for assistance, verify details before submission, and call the helpline (1800-180-2060) for support.
